Hauliers have warned of long delays as a backlog of Christmas parcels is building at the Welsh port after Storm Darragh damaged critical infrastructure

An Post has addressed concerns that interruption to ferry traffic due to storm damage could result in gifts and other parcels from Europe and the UK not arriving in time for Christmas .

However, An Post has moved to quell fears that presents and other goods may not arrive in time for Christmas Day, promising to be ready for the parcels from Holyhead when they arrive in Ireland. “We invested €6 million in expanding our parcel tech and capacity in Portlaoise and Athlone hubs this year, and we have 1,400 Christmas casuals helping to process and deliver parcels and letters too,” they added.

“We’re seeing huge volumes of Christmas cards being posted in the last few days, particularly to family and friends abroad. The latest date for guaranteed parcel delivery across Europe is today, and next Tuesday for cards.”
